Android读取文本原始资源文件

作者:编程家 分类: android 时间:2025-12-20

Android读取文本原始资源文件

在Android开发中,我们经常会遇到需要读取文本文件的情况,而这些文本文件通常会作为应用的原始资源文件存放在res目录下。本文将介绍如何在Android中读取这些原始资源文件,并 。

读取原始资源文件

要读取原始资源文件,首先需要在res目录下创建一个raw文件夹,并将需要读取的文本文件放置在该文件夹下。接下来,在代码中通过资源ID来获取文件的输入流,进而读取文件内容。

下面是一个简单的示例代码,演示了如何读取一个名为example.txt的原始资源文件:

java

InputStream inputStream = getResources().openRawResource(R.raw.example);

文章

在读取到文本文件的内容后,我们可以利用自然语言处理的技术,将这些内容生成一篇文章。自然语言处理是一门研究如何让计算机理解和处理人类语言的学科,它包括文本分词、句法分析、情感分析等多个领域。

下面是一个简单的示例代码,演示了如何使用自然语言处理库来生成一篇文章:

java

String text = ""; // 读取到的文件内容

NLProcessor processor = new NLProcessor();

String article = processor.generateArticle(text);

添加标题

为了让文章更加清晰易读,我们可以在文章的中间段落中添加标题。利用HTML的标签可以实现这一效果。下面是一个示例代码,演示了如何在文章中添加标题:

java

String articleWithHeading = article.substring(0, article.length() / 2)

+ "中间段落标题"

+ article.substring(article.length() / 2);

以上就是使用Android读取文本原始资源文件,并 ,并添加标题的完整示例。通过这种方式,我们可以方便地将文本资源转化为可读性更强的文章,并在应用中展示给用户。